Photo Exhibit on Ozark Log Buildings
Single Pens, Saddlebags and Dogtrots, a photo exhibit featuring Ozark log homes and outbuildings, will be on display through May 11 at the Shiloh Museum of Ozark History in Springdale. The photo exhibit explores the construction and architectural styles of log buildings, as well as what it was like to live in them.

Exhibit on the History of the University Museum
From Archaeopteryx to Zapus, an exhibit on the history of the University of Arkansas Museum, will be on display through Jan. 11, 2014. The exhibit will showcase more than 200 objects and specimens on loan from the University Museum collections, including a black bear, emu egg, Plains Indians artifacts, Native American pottery, fossils, the Fayetteville meteorite, fluorescent minerals, and the keyboard and timer from the Old Main carillon which used to chime the hours and for special events.
